The 964 katalog lists 2 parts for the front right cover for models without power steering.

1) 964 106 283 76. I found this picture:
http://www.fvd.de/us/en/Porsche-0/-/..._right.html964

2) 964 106 283 01. I can't find a picture so have no idea what the difference is.

Comparing the 993 diagram to the 964 diagram for the covers, it looks like the front covers are quite different so I would be surprised if these would work. I've only seen references to some people with similar setups using custom fabricated pieces.
